Red Mesa Express stands as a reliable service station in Page, Arizona, catering to the steady stream of tourists and locals navigating the scenic routes of the American Southwest. Located at the intersection of N Navajo Dr and US-89-LOOP, this establishment has earned a solid reputation among travelers for its clean facilities and convenient services. The station operates as both a fuel stop and convenience store, providing essential supplies for visitors exploring the region’s world-renowned attractions. Page serves as a crucial hub for tourists visiting Antelope Canyon, Horseshoe Bend, Lake Powell, and the Grand Canyon, making Red Mesa Express a valuable waypoint for travelers requiring fuel, snacks, beverages, and basic travel necessities. Customer feedback consistently highlights the cleanliness of the facilities, particularly the restrooms, which represent a significant amenity for long-distance travelers. The station accepts all major credit cards and maintains competitive pricing, making it an accessible option for visitors from diverse backgrounds and budgets.
Red Mesa Express is easily accessible by car via N Navajo Dr, located at the intersection with US-89-LOOP. The station sits along major tourist routes connecting Page to regional attractions including the Grand Canyon, Antelope Canyon, and Utah’s national parks. Most visitors arrive by personal vehicle or rental car, as Page serves as a key stopping point for Southwest road trips.
Red Mesa Express accepts American Express, Discover, MasterCard, and Visa credit cards.
Yes, clean restroom facilities are available for customers only.
The station operates daily from 6:00 AM to 10:00 PM.
Free parking is available on-site for customers.
The station provides both gasoline and diesel fuel services.
The station is approximately 135-139 miles from Grand Canyon South Rim (2.5-2.75 hours drive).
The store offers snacks, beverages, and essential travel supplies for tourists and locals.
While accessible, parking can become cramped during busy periods, particularly for larger vehicles.
